Marwari Yuva Manch Inaugurates 43rd Amritdhara at Utkal Association, Sakchi

Permanent Drinking Water Facility to Benefit Devotees Visiting Jagannath Temple

The Steel City branch of Marwari Yuva Manch has inaugurated its 43rd and sixth permanent Amritdhara (drinking water facility) for the 24-25 session at the Utkal Association in Garmanala, Sakchi, on June 15 at 8 pm.

JAMSHEDPUR – In a bid to provide relief to devotees visiting the grand Jagannath Temple at the Utkal Association premises in Garmanala, Sakchi, the Steel City branch of Marwari Yuva Manch has inaugurated its 43rd and sixth permanent Amritdhara.

The Utkal Association members informed that the temple attracts numerous devotees daily who come to offer prayers and seek blessings from Mahaprabhu Jagannath.

With the upcoming Rath Yatra on July 7, thousands of devotees are expected to throng the temple to witness the grand event and partake in the Mahaprasad.

The newly established Amritdhara, which provides cool drinking water, will prove to be a boon for the devotees, especially during the scorching summer heat.

The Amritdhara was set up with the assistance provided by the late Munna Babu Gupta Trust, courtesy of Naveen Seth.

The inauguration ceremony was conducted under the chairmanship of branch president Praveen Agarwal, in the presence of secretary Alok Agarwal, convener Navneet Bansal, Anuj Gupta, Shankar Singhal, Lippu Sharma, and members of the Utkal Association Committee.

The initiative by the Marwari Yuva Manch to establish a permanent drinking water facility at the Utkal Association premises demonstrates their commitment to serving the community and ensuring the well-being of devotees visiting the Jagannath Temple.
